These essays emerge from different crucial and complex conflicts:
from the memory of a bishop, Bartolome de las Casas, urging the
pope of his time to cleanse the church of complicity with violence,
oppression, and slavery; from the lament and defiance of so many
Middle Eastern women, victims of male domination and too many wars;
from the voices bursting out from the colonial margins that dare to
question and transgress the norms and laws imposed by colonizers
and conquerors; from the emerging and diverse theological
disruptions of traditional orthodoxies and rigid dogmatisms; from
the denial of human rights to immigrant communities, living in the
shadows of opulent societies; from the use of the sacred Hebrew
Scriptures to displace and dispossess the indigenous peoples of
Palestine. The essays belong to different intellectual genres and
conceptual crossroads and are thus illustrative of the dialogic
imagination that the Russian intellectual Mikhail Bakhtin
considered basic to any serious intellectual enterprise.They are
also the literary sediment of years of sharing lectures, dialogues,
and debates in several academic institutions in the United States,
Mexico, Argentina, Chile, Costa Rica, Malaysia, Switzerland,
Germany, and Palestine.
